Quality Assessment
As of 10 July 2026, Swarnsarita Jewels India Ltd's quality grade is assessed as below average. The company has exhibited operating losses, which weigh heavily on its long-term fundamental strength. Over the past five years, net sales have grown at an annualised rate of 8.57%, while operating profit has increased at a similar pace of 8.64%. Despite this growth, the company struggles with profitability, as evidenced by recent quarterly results showing a significant decline in profit before tax (PBT) and net profit after tax (PAT).
The latest quarterly data reveals a PBT (excluding other income) of negative ₹9.77 crores, a steep fall of 357.8% compared to the previous four-quarter average. Similarly, PAT for the quarter stands at a loss of ₹6.78 crores, down 356.3% from the prior average. These figures highlight ongoing operational challenges and a lack of earnings stability, which contribute to the below-average quality rating.

Financial Trend and Stability
The financial grade is flat, indicating a lack of significant improvement or deterioration in the company's financial health over recent periods. One notable concern is the company's high leverage, with a Debt to EBITDA ratio of 4.52 times, signalling a considerable debt burden relative to earnings. This level of indebtedness raises questions about the company's ability to service its debt obligations comfortably, especially given its operating losses.
Cash and cash equivalents have also declined, with the half-year figure at a low ₹3.21 crores, limiting liquidity buffers. Additionally, 57.66% of promoter shares are pledged, which can exert downward pressure on the stock price in volatile or falling markets, adding to investor risk.
